#if !__has_builtin(__builtin_available)
#include <initializer_list>
#include <QtCore/qoperatingsystemversion.h>
#include <QtCore/qversionnumber.h>
QT_BEGIN_NAMESPACE
struct qt_clang_builtin_available_os_version_data {
QOperatingSystemVersion::OSType type;
const char *version;
};
static inline bool qt_clang_builtin_available(
const std::initializer_list<qt_clang_builtin_available_os_version_data> &versions)
{
for (auto it = versions.begin(); it != versions.end(); ++it) {
if (QOperatingSystemVersion::currentType() == it->type) {
const auto current = QOperatingSystemVersion::current();
return QVersionNumber(
current.majorVersion(),
current.minorVersion(),
current.microVersion()) >= QVersionNumber::fromString(
QString::fromLatin1(it->version));
}
}
// Result is true if the platform is not any of the checked ones; this matches behavior of
// LLVM __builtin_available and @available constructs
return true;
}
QT_END_NAMESPACE
#define QT_AVAILABLE_OS_VER(os, ver)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available_os_version_data){\
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(QOperatingSystemVersion)::os, #ver}
#define QT_AVAILABLE_CAT(L, R) QT_AVAILABLE_CAT_(L, R)
#define QT_AVAILABLE_CAT_(L, R) L ## R
#define QT_AVAILABLE_EXPAND(...) QT_AVAILABLE_OS_VER(__VA_ARGS__)
#define Q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(os_ver) QT_AVAILABLE_EXPAND(QT_AVAILABLE_CAT(Q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T_, os_ver))
#define Q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T_macOS MacOS,
#define Q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T_iOS IOS,
#define Q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T_tvOS TvOS,
#define Q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T_watchOS WatchOS,
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E0(e)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available)({})
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E1(a, e)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available)({Q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(a)})
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E2(a, b, e)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available)({Q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(a),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(b)})
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E3(a, b, c, e)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available)({Q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(a),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(b),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(c)})
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E4(a, b, c, d, e) \
QT_PREPEND_NAMESPACE(qt_clang_builtin_available)({Q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(a),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(b),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(c), \
QT_AVAILABLE_SPLIT(d)})
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E_ARG(arg0, arg1, arg2, arg3, arg4, arg5, ...) arg5
#define Q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E_CHOOSER(...) Q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E_ARG(__VA_ARGS__, \
Q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E4, \
Q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E3, \
Q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E2, \
Q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E1, \
Q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E0, )
#define __builtin_available(...) QT_BUILTIN_AVAILABLE_CHOOSER(__VA_ARGS__)(__VA_ARGS__)
#endif // !__has_builtin(__builtin_available)
